Death of the Member for Caversham.
Discovery of Silver Lead. ;.'.<
Plummer Still at Large.
DUNEDIN. Mr Kichard Seaward Cantrell, the, late member for Caversham in the General Assembly, died yesterday. A lode of silver lead has been discovered on the Garrick range ten inches thick. It has been traced a considerable distance. A practical miner has visited it and says that, it is the richest lode he ever saw. Up to this moment there has been no trace discovered of the escaped prisoner Plummer. Contradictory reports keep reaching the police of his whereabouts. One report says that he has been seen thirty miles away from 'Dunedin.
